DIGEST OF SB 516 (Updated February 9, 2005 1:06 pm - DI 106)
Victim notification. Permits establishment of an automated victim notification system within the department of correction and permits a crime victim to register for the system by telephone. Provides that the system automatically notifies a registered crime victim by telephone when: (1) a committed offender's status changes; (2) the offender is released or has escaped; or (3) the status of certain court cases changes. Provides that the system must notify residents of a sex offender living nearby. Allows a crime victim to obtain the most recent status of an offender by calling the system. Requires the department of correction to update the system frequently. Provides that there is no cause of action based on the system's failure to notify. Requires the sheriffs to assist the department of correction and provide personnel to coordinate data for victim notification services. Permits the victim and witness assistance fund to provide funding for a victim notification system. Requires a sheriff or police chief of Indianapolis to notify the department of correction when a sex offender files a new sex offender registration form.
